Abstract
A valve system for use in inflating packers mounted on mandrels. The valve system uses one or more valves to permit, through the use of seals, the flow of fluid from the interior of a tubular mandrel to the interior of the inflatable packer when pressure applied in the mandrel exceeds at least a minimum pressure. The differential pressure across reciprocating seals is minimized through exposure of one or both sides, directly or indirectly, to the external pressure of the mandrel and packer, the exposure including the use of a check valve to permit flow from the exterior of the mandrel.
